#209d7f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#209d7f is composed of 12.5% red, 61.6%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.1%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 165.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 37.1%. #209d7f color hex could be obtained by blending #40fffe with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#209d7f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a08 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#209d7f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a6361 is the less saturated color, while #03ba8e is the most saturated one.
